Content Fuel Cell System Testing:
- Measurement of voltage, current, temperature, pressure, volume flow based on P&ID plan
- Data acquisition system: INCA
- Measurement of legislation cycles (WLTP & NEDC) on roller dynamometer test bench at:
• official, ambient temperature (25°C / 23°C)
• cold start (-7°C)
• warm condition (35°C)
- Measurement on roller dynamometer test bench at different low temperatures and driving modes (Frost-start characterization)
- Fuel Cell stack & system mapping and efficiency investigations:
• Generation of fuel cell stack polarization curves via successive stack load increase (velocity increase)
• Starting from 0 km/h to max. velocity, with each load step being hold until stabilization of the systems temperatures, flow levels and output power is reached
• Start up and shut down investigations by measurement of the different components' operation procedures
- Fuel Cell System frost start characterization at -30°C:
• Pre-conditioning of the vehicle in a specific climate chamber
• Gas pedal tip-in and measurement of the energy flows to determine the systems performance related to operation temperature
